Review by Michael Pellecchia
What makes an investment classic? Good information presentation plus idiomatic writing do it for me. Plus a taste of the unusual. All that is here from an expert in spin-offs, rights offerings, warrants and options, and other investments off the market's beaten path.
Greenblatt, founder of Gotham Capital, cut his teeth on Benjamin Graham's exhortations to ignore "Mr. Market" and also to buy with a sufficient "margin of safety" in the price. From that standard territory he moves into the "twilight zone" where the fewest investors are found chasing values that require a little digging for.
Because this book brings together an unusual set of ideas, is short and to the point, and benefits greatly from the author's style and personality, it has all the makings of an investment classic.
